Definition / Gloss

Strong's Number:H1732
Word:דָּוִד דָּוִידּ
Part of Speech:name
Etymology:from the same as H1730
Language:Hebrew
Occurrences:1075
Transliteration:David
Phonetic Spelling/Pronunciation:daw-veed' (rarely (fully) Daviyd {daw-veed'};) n/p.
Meaning:1. loving 2. David, the youngest son of Jesse
KJV Renderings:David.

Use Strong's responsibly

Strong's is an index and starting point, not the final meaning of a word. Do not build doctrine from a gloss, root, or number. Test meaning by sentence, grammar, authorial usage, context, and the passage argument.

Brown-Driver-Briggs Enhanced

BDB1866

דָּוִד, דָּוִיד1066 proper name, masculine David, son of יִשַׂי, king of Israel, whose dynasty remained on the throne of Jerusalem till the Babylonian exile (compare 2Sam 7:11-15 etc.) (beloved one ? compare BaNB 189; according to SayceModern Rev. 1884, 158 ff.; Rel. Babylonian 53, 56 f. originally Dodo , title of sun-god worshipped in Israel compare דודה name of divinity among east Jordan Israelites MI12 ) — דָּוִד always Ruth, Samuel, Kings (except 1Kgs 3:14; 1Kgs 11:4; 1Kgs 11:36) Psalms, Proverbs, Ecclesiastes, Isaiah, Jeremiah; also 1Chr 13:6; Ezek 34:24; Ezek 37:24; Ezek 37:25 (c. 790 t.); דָּוִיד always Zechariah, Chronicles (except 1Chr 13:6), Ezra, Nehemiah; also Amos 6:5 (where gloss according to PetersHebraica. Apr. 1886, p. 175) Amos 9:11; Hos 3:5 ; Ezek 34:23 ; 1Kgs 3:14 ; 1Kgs 11:4; 1Kgs 11:36; Song 4:4 (c. 276 t.); — first named 1Sam 16:13 compare also Ruth 4:17; Ruth 4:22; 2Sam 1:1 +, 1Kgs 1:1 +, 1Kgs 2:1 +, etc. (see above); in titles of Psalm 3-9, 11-32, 34-41, 51-65, 68-70, 86, 101, 103, 108-110, 122, 124, 131, 133, 138-145 (73 in all); also in Ps 18:51 (= 2Sam 22:51); 2Sam 72:20; 2Sam 89:36; 2Sam 89:50; 2Sam 122:5; 2Sam 132:17 עַבְדִּי ׳ ד (׳ י speaks) 2Sam 3:18; 2Sam 7:5; 2Sam 7:8 = 1Chr 17:4; 1Chr 17:7 compare 1Chr 17:26 = 1Chr 17:24, also 1Kgs 8:24; 1Kgs 8:25; 1Kgs 8:26; 1Kgs 8:66 = 2Chr 6:15; 2Chr 6:16; 2Chr 6:17; 2Chr 11:32; 2Chr 11:34; 2Chr 11:36; 2Chr 11:38; 2Chr 14:8; 2Kgs 8:19; 2Kgs 19:34 = Isa 37:35; 2Kgs 20:6 compare further Ps 18:1; Ps 36:1 (both titles compare above) Ps 78:70; Ps 89:4; Ps 89:21; Ps 132:10; Ps 144:10; Jer 33:21; Jer 33:22; Jer 33:26 so also as represented in coming (Messianic) ruler Ezek 34:23; Ezek 34:24; Ezek 37:24; Ezek 37:25, compare Hos 3:5; Jer 30:9 (see עֶבֶד ). Phrases are:

a. ׳ עִיר ד (according to SayceMod.Rev.l.c. originally city of god Dod [o]) = stronghold or citadel of Zion, 2Sam 5:7; 2Sam 5:9 = 1Chr 11:5; 1Chr 11:7; 2Sam 6:10; 2Sam 6:12; 2Sam 6:16 = 1Chr 13:13; 1Chr 15:1; 1Chr 15:29, compare Isa 22:9 especially of burial of kings 1Kgs 2:10; 1Kgs 3:1; 1Kgs 8:1 = 2Chr 5:2; 1Kgs 9:24 = 2Chr 8:11; 1Kgs 11:27 1Kgs 11:43 = 2Chr 9:31; 1Kgs 14:13; 1Kgs 15:8 = 2Chr 12:16; 2Chr 13:23; 1Kgs 15:24 = 2Chr 9:31; 1Kgs 14:31; 1Kgs 15:8 = 2Chr 12:16; 2Chr 13:23; 1Kgs 15:24 = 2Chr 16:14; 1Kgs 22:50 = 2Chr 21:1; 2Kgs 8:24 = 2Chr 21:20; 2Kgs 9:28; 2Kgs 12:22 = 2Chr 24:25; 2Kgs 14:20; 2Kgs 15:7, 2Kgs 15:38 = 2Chr 27:9; 2Kgs 16:20 burial of Jehoiada 2Chr 24:16 further 2Chr 32:5; 2Chr 32:30; 2Chr 33:14; Neh 12:37 compare also ׳ קִרְיַת חָנָה ד Isa 29:1.
b. ׳ בֵּית ד 2Sam 3:1; 2Sam 3:6 + (compare בַּיִת 5.c.
c. ׳ אֹהֶל ד Isa 16:5 (compare אֹהֶל 2).
d. ׳ סֻכַּת ד Amos 9:11 (compare סֻכָּה below סכך).
e. ׳ כִּסֵּא ד 2Sam 3:10 compare 1Kgs 1:37; 1Kgs 2:12; 1Kgs 2:24; 1Kgs 2:45; Isa 9:6 ; Jer 17:25 ; Jer 22:2; Jer 22:30 ; Jer 29:16; Jer 36:30 compare Jer 13:13; Jer 22:4, (compare also כִּסֵּא ).
f. ׳ קִבְרֵי ד Neh 3:16 compare 2Chr 32:33 ׳ קִבְרֵי בְנֵידֿ (compare קֶבֶר).
g. ׳ מִגְדַּל ד Song 4:4.
h. אישׁ האלהים ׳ כְּלֵישִֿׁיר ד Neh 12:36 .
i. ׳ אֱלֹהֵי ד 2Kgs 20:5 + (compare אֱלֹהִים 4.b.).
j. ׳ חַסְדֵי ד 2Chr 6:42; Isa 55:3 (compare 2Sam 7:15; 1Kgs 3:6 ; Ps 89:50; 2Chr 1:8 etc.). — (On text note the following: — דָּוִד 1Sam 30:20a strike out ᵐ5 ᵑ7 We Dr; 2Sam 3:5 read probably name of a former husband of Eglah We Dr; 2Sam 13:39 read רוּחַ Wep.223 Dr; 2Sam 19:44 read בְּכוֺר (for בדוד) ᵐ5 The We Dr; insert דָּוִד 2Sam 9:11; 2Sam 15:32 & 2Sam 24:15 ᵐ5 We Dr; in 1Chr 18:12; Ps 60:1 אבשׁי & יואב are less original than דָּוִד 2Sam 8:13 We Dr).
